Instructions
 

  • Heat oil in a large stock pot.
  • Add onions, tomato paste, diced tomatoes, water, pepper, parsley, garlic powder, basil, oregano, thyme, and vegetable base. Simmer uncovered over medium heat for 5 minutes. Set aside for step 5.
  • Critical Control Point: Heat to 140 °F or higher.
  • Place 25 individual soufflé cups on a sheet pan (18" x 26" x 1").
    For 25 servings, use 1 pan.
    For 50 servings, use 2 pans.
  • Using 1 fl oz ladle, portion 2 Tbsp tomato sauce into each soufflé cup.
  • Critical Control Point: Hold for hot service at 140 °F or higher.
  • Serve 1 soufflé cup (2 Tbsp).
